Dendritic Cells
Immune cells that process antigen material and present it on the surface to other cells of the immune system.
B Cells
A type of white blood cell that plays a key role in the body's immune response by producing antibodies.
Monocytes
A type of white blood cell that plays a key role in the immune system by removing pathogens and dead or damaged cells from the blood.
Helper T Cells
A type of T cell that plays a crucial role in the immune system by assisting other cells in recognizing and fighting off infections.
